Description

Approaches to project scheduling under resource constraints are discussed in this book.

After an overview of different models, it deals with exact and heuristic scheduling algorithms.

The focus is on the development of new algorithms. Computational experiments demonstrate the efficiency of the new heuristics.

Finally, it is shown how the models and methods discussed here can be applied to projects in research and development as well as market research.
